IETF

``

Descripción general

El IETF (Internet Engineering Task Force) es una organización internacional abierta y voluntaria responsable del desarrollo y mantenimiento de los estándares técnicos de Internet. Su trabajo define cómo funcionan los protocolos fundamentales que permiten la interoperabilidad global de redes, servicios y aplicaciones.

El IETF no es un organismo gubernamental ni una entidad formal de estandarización tradicional, sino una comunidad técnica basada en el consenso y la revisión abierta (rough consensus and running code).

Objetivos principales

  • Definir y mantener estándares abiertos para Internet
  • Garantizar la interoperabilidad entre sistemas heterogéneos
  • Evolucionar la arquitectura de Internet de forma escalable y segura
  • Servir como foro técnico neutral para la innovación en redes

Relación con otros marcos y disciplinas

  • infraestructura IT: El IETF define los protocolos base (IP, TCP, DNS, TLS, HTTP) sobre los que se construye toda la infraestructura de red
  • ITIL: Aunque ITIL se centra en la gestión de servicios, depende de estándares IETF para la conectividad, seguridad y disponibilidad de servicios

Organización y estructura

El IETF se organiza en Áreas y Grupos de Trabajo (Working Groups), cada uno enfocado en un dominio técnico específico.

Áreas principales

  • Security (SEC) – Criptografía, autenticación, TLS, PKI
  • Routing (RTG) – Protocolos de enrutamiento (BGP, OSPF, IS-IS)
  • Internet (INT) – IP, direccionamiento, movilidad
  • Transport (TSV) – TCP, UDP, QUIC
  • Applications and Real-Time (ART) – HTTP, email, tiempo real
  • Operations and Management (OPS) – Gestión de red, observabilidad

Grupos de Trabajo

  • Creados para resolver problemas técnicos concretos
  • Tienen un alcance definido y temporal
  • Producen borradores (Internet-Drafts) que pueden convertirse en RFC

Estándares y documentos

El resultado principal del trabajo del IETF son los RFC (Request for Comments), documentos técnicos numerados y publicados de forma permanente.

Tipos de RFC

  • Standards Track
    • Proposed Standard
    • Internet Standard
  • Best Current Practice (BCP)
  • Informational
  • Experimental
  • Historic

No todos los RFC son estándares; algunos documentan prácticas, experimentos o información histórica relevante.

Proceso de estandarización

  • Propuesta inicial como Internet-Draft
  • Discusión abierta en listas de correo y reuniones
  • Implementaciones reales y validación práctica
  • Revisión por el IESG (Internet Engineering Steering Group)
  • Publicación final como RFC

El principio clave es consenso técnico, no votación formal.

Herramientas y recursos oficiales

  • IETF Datatracker
    • Seguimiento de Internet-Drafts y RFC
    • Estado de Grupos de Trabajo
    • Calendario de reuniones
    • Historial de revisiones y decisiones

Casos de uso prácticos

  • Diseño de arquitecturas de red basadas en estándares abiertos
  • Implementación de protocolos seguros (TLS, IPsec, OAuth-related RFC)
  • Integración de sistemas distribuidos y microservicios
  • Evaluación de compatibilidad entre proveedores
  • Auditorías técnicas y cumplimiento de estándares de red

Importancia estratégica

  • Base técnica de Internet y la nube
  • Reduce el vendor lock-in
  • Permite escalabilidad global
  • Fundamental para seguridad, rendimiento y resiliencia de sistemas modernos

Conceptos clave asociados

  • RFC
  • Internet-Draft
  • Rough consensus and running code
  • Interoperabilidad
  • Protocolos abiertos
  • Gobernanza técnica distribuida

IETF – Conceptos avanzados y temas complementarios

$= dv.current().file.tags.join(“ “)

Gobernanza y roles clave

El IETF opera mediante una estructura ligera de gobernanza técnica, enfocada en la coordinación y revisión, no en control jerárquico.

IESG (Internet Engineering Steering Group)

  • Responsable de la dirección técnica del IETF
  • Aprueba la publicación de RFC
  • Supervisa el trabajo de las Áreas y Grupos de Trabajo
  • Actúa como punto de resolución de conflictos técnicos

IAB (Internet Architecture Board)

  • Define la arquitectura global de Internet
  • Emite opiniones arquitectónicas y RFC informativos
  • Supervisa relaciones externas y coherencia técnica a largo plazo
  • Actúa como órgano de apelación final

Relación con la IANA

La IANA (Internet Assigned Numbers Authority) gestiona recursos críticos definidos por el IETF.

  • Espacios de direcciones IP
  • Parámetros de protocolos
  • Puertos y números de sistema
  • Zonas raíz del DNS (en coordinación con ICANN)

El IETF define políticas técnicas, la IANA las implementa operativamente.

Ciclo de vida de un RFC

  • Publicación inicial como RFC
  • Puede ser:
    • Actualizado por RFC posteriores
    • Obsoleto (Obsoleted by)
    • Declarado histórico
  • Los estándares evolucionan sin perder trazabilidad

Este modelo evita versiones cerradas y mantiene un historial técnico auditable.

Seguridad en el IETF

La seguridad es un principio transversal, no un añadido posterior.

  • Requisito obligatorio de Security Considerations en RFC
  • Preferencia por:
    • Cifrado por defecto
    • Autenticación fuerte
    • Minimización de metadatos
  • Influencia directa en el enfoque secure by design moderno

Participación y modelo abierto

Cualquier persona puede participar en el IETF sin afiliación formal.

  • Listas de correo públicas como canal principal
  • Reuniones presenciales y virtuales
  • No existe membresía ni cuotas
  • La influencia se basa en la calidad técnica, no en el cargo

Reuniones IETF

  • Tres reuniones globales al año
  • Formato híbrido (presencial + remoto)
  • Trabajo distribuido durante todo el año vía correo y repositorios
  • Las decisiones no se toman solo en reuniones

Relaciones con otros organismos

El IETF colabora y mantiene liaisons técnicos con:

  • W3C (tecnologías web)
  • IEEE (capas físicas y enlace)
  • ISO / IEC
  • ETSI
  • ICANN

Cada organismo mantiene su ámbito de responsabilidad, evitando solapamientos.

Principios técnicos fundamentales

  • End-to-End Principle
  • Backward compatibility
  • Incremental deployment
  • Escalabilidad global
  • Independencia de proveedor

Estos principios guían decisiones incluso cuando no se documentan explícitamente.

Impacto en tecnologías modernas

  • Base de protocolos cloud-native
  • Fundamento de Kubernetes networking
  • Protocolos de identidad y autenticación modernos
  • HTTP/3 y QUIC para aplicaciones de alto rendimiento
  • Estándares clave para Zero Trust

Relevancia para arquitectos y compliance

  • Referencia técnica neutral en auditorías
  • Soporte normativo indirecto en marcos regulatorios
  • Base técnica para políticas de seguridad y redes
  • Criterio de evaluación de soluciones propietarias

Conceptos clave adicionales

  • IESG
  • IAB
  • IANA
  • Liaison
  • Security Considerations
  • Backward compatibility
  • Incremental deployment
  • Arquitectura end-to-end

IETF – Recursos y herramientas (2025-2026)

$= dv.current().file.tags.join(“ “)

Recursos oficiales

Sitios y seguimiento de estándares

  • IETF Datatracker – Principal plataforma para:
    • Ver el estado de borradores (Internet-Drafts)
    • Obtener agenda de reuniones y materiales
    • Acceder a estadísticas de Grupos de Trabajo y RFC
  • IETF RFC archive – Archivo oficial de RFC con búsqueda y metadatos
  • RFC-Editor.org – Distribución y publicación de RFC. Nueva web en despliegue a 2026 con:
    • Búsqueda avanzada por contenido y metadatos
    • Visualización optimizada
    • Tooling mejorado de navegación

Herramientas de publicación y producción de estándares

Datatracker y ecosistema

  • Repositorio de Datatracker en GitHub: código fuente para desarrollo, pruebas locales y contribución a la herramienta principal
    ietf-tools/datatracker
  • Funciones en Datatracker (desarrollo activo en 2025-2026):
    • Integración y API expandida
    • Paneles de control para IESG
    • Optimización de acceso y caché de contenidos
    • Servicio de autenticación separado para mayor escalabilidad

Herramientas del RFC Production Center (RPC)

  • Modernización del workflow de producción de RFC:
    • “Purple”: nuevo sistema de gestión de documentos
    • “Red”: front-end modernizado del sitio del RFC Editor
    • “DraftForge”: editor visual para redactar borradores RFC
    • Integración de validadores, XML y GitHub, y posible soporte de kramdown-rfc (markdown)

Desarrollo y reuniones de herramientas

  • Las reuniones del Tools Team publican notas técnicas:
    • Rendimiento del servicio
    • Cambios en cache y CDN
    • Mejoras en API y autorización
    • Integración con otros sistemas internos de IETF
      Notes IETF – Tools Team

Clientes y APIs útiles

  • APIs de Datatracker:
    • Acceder programáticamente a datos de Grupos de Trabajo, Documents, agendas y minutos
    • Integrar con scripts automatizados de seguimiento de estándares
      Datatracker API
  • APIs del RFC Editor (evolución prevista a 2026):
    • Interfaces para búsquedas avanzadas dentro de RFC completos
    • Posible salida JSON/estructurada para consumo por herramientas externas
      RFC Editor

Lectura y búsquedas mejoradas

  • Buscadores internos de IETF:
    • Mejoras en búsqueda centralizada con indexación más eficiente
    • Integración de motores de búsqueda modernos planificada a 2026
  • Repositorios externos:
    • Índices bibliográficos: listado completo de RFC con metadatos descargables
      List of RFCs

Participación y colaboración

  • Listas de correo públicas IETF:
    • Canales para discusión de Internet-Drafts, grupos y agendas
    • Archivo histórico accesible y buscable
      IETF Mailing Lists
  • Participación en reuniones:
    • Tres reuniones anuales (formato híbrido)
    • Calendario oficial y materiales disponibles en Datatracker
      IETF Meetings

Protocolos, herramientas y desarrollos relevantes

  • Protocolos emergentes/recientes:
    • RESTful Provisioning Protocol (RPP) – Alternativa web-native para gestión de dominios vía HTTPS/JSON
      RPP RFCs

Recursos de desarrollo complementarios

  • Repositorios y proyectos relacionados:
  • Archivadores y documentación general:
    • Edición del RFC index en texto plano para análisis masivo o descargas automatizadas
      RFC Index

Buenas prácticas con herramientas IETF

  • Automatizar:
    • Seguimiento de borradores usando APIs
    • Integración de RFC y metadatos en pipelines de CI/CD
  • Contribuir:
    • Revisar notas y agendas públicas para coordinación con Grupos de Trabajo
    • Utilizar herramientas RPC para producción local de borradores
  • Monitorear:
    • Noticias y actualizaciones en el blog oficial del IETF
      IETF Blog

Accesibilidad y UX

  • Evolución del sitio RFC-Editor.org enfocada en:
    • Accesibilidad para personas con discapacidad
    • Mejor explotación de metadatos para búsquedas filtradas
    • Interfaces más limpias y legibles

Referencias rápidas útiles

  • Docs oficiales: RFC y Datatracker
  • GitHub de herramientas: ietf-tools/datatracker
  • Notas del Tools Team
  • API de Datatracker para integración externa
  • RFC index y repositorio completo para datos históricos

IETF – Glosario de conceptos

Organización y gobernanza

  • IETF (Internet Engineering Task Force)
    • Comunidad técnica abierta que desarrolla estándares de Internet
  • IESG (Internet Engineering Steering Group)
    • Órgano responsable de la dirección técnica y aprobación de RFC
  • IAB (Internet Architecture Board)
    • Supervisión de la arquitectura global de Internet
  • IANA (Internet Assigned Numbers Authority)
    • Gestión de parámetros de protocolos, puertos y recursos numéricos
  • Working Group (Grupo de Trabajo)
    • Equipo temporal enfocado en un problema técnico concreto
  • Area Director
    • Responsable de coordinar un área técnica del IETF

Documentos y estándares

  • RFC (Request for Comments)
    • Documento técnico oficial publicado por el IETF
  • Internet-Draft
    • Borrador preliminar de un RFC en discusión
  • Standards Track
    • Categoría de RFC orientados a convertirse en estándares
  • Best Current Practice (BCP)
    • Documentos que definen prácticas recomendadas
  • Informational RFC
    • Documentos descriptivos sin carácter normativo
  • Experimental RFC
    • Propuestas técnicas en fase de validación
  • Historic RFC
    • Estándares obsoletos o reemplazados

Principios técnicos

  • Rough consensus and running code
    • Decisiones basadas en consenso técnico y pruebas reales
  • End-to-End Principle
    • La inteligencia debe residir en los extremos de la red
  • Backward compatibility
    • Capacidad de mantener compatibilidad con versiones anteriores
  • Incremental deployment
    • Despliegue progresivo sin cambios disruptivos
  • Interoperabilidad
    • Capacidad de sistemas distintos para trabajar juntos

Procesos y ciclos de vida

  • Last Call
    • Fase final de revisión pública antes de publicar un RFC
  • IESG Review
    • Revisión técnica formal del documento
  • Obsoletes / Updates
    • Relación entre RFC nuevos y documentos previos
  • Appeal
    • Mecanismo formal de impugnación de decisiones técnicas

Seguridad y arquitectura

  • Security Considerations
    • Sección obligatoria en RFC sobre implicaciones de seguridad
  • Secure by design
    • Seguridad integrada desde el diseño del protocolo
  • Cryptographic agility
    • Capacidad de cambiar algoritmos criptográficos
  • Privacy considerations
    • Análisis de impacto en privacidad de usuarios
  • Threat model
    • Modelo de amenazas asociado al protocolo

Herramientas y plataformas

  • IETF Datatracker
    • Seguimiento de documentos, grupos y reuniones
  • RFC Editor
    • Entidad responsable de la publicación de RFC
  • RPC (RFC Production Center)
    • Infraestructura de edición y producción de RFC
  • kramdown-rfc
    • Formato markdown para redactar RFC
  • Notes IETF
    • Plataforma colaborativa de documentación y reuniones

Participación y comunidad

  • Listas de correo
    • Canal principal de discusión técnica
  • IETF Meeting
    • Reuniones globales presenciales y remotas
  • Liaison
    • Relación formal con otros organismos de estandarización
  • Volunteer model
    • Participación basada en contribución voluntaria
  • Open process
    • Transparencia total en discusiones y decisiones

Relación con la infraestructura IT

  • Protocol stack
    • Conjunto de protocolos en capas (IP, TCP, HTTP)
  • Network interoperability
    • Base técnica de infraestructuras híbridas y cloud
  • Zero Trust networking
    • Modelos de seguridad apoyados en estándares IETF
  • Cloud-native networking
    • Uso de protocolos IETF en entornos distribuidos

Conceptos emergentes

  • QUIC
    • Protocolo de transporte moderno sobre UDP
  • HTTP/3
    • Versión de HTTP basada en QUIC
  • RPP (RESTful Provisioning Protocol)
    • Protocolo web-native para gestión de dominios
  • Post-quantum cryptography
    • Criptografía resistente a computación cuántica
  • Observability protocols
    • Estándares para métricas, trazas y telemetría